WebJan 21, 2024 · 6. Use loc[] &amp; Lambda to Filter a Pandas Series. You can also filter the Pandas Series using Series.loc[] along with lambda function. The following example returns values from a series where values are equal to 23000. # Use loc[] and lambda to filter a pandas series ser2 = ser.loc[lambda x : x == 23000] print(ser2) Yields below output. WebDec 11, 2024 · To filter rows based on dates, first format the dates in the DataFrame to datetime64 type. Then use the DataFrame.loc [] and DataFrame.query [] function from the Pandas package to specify a filter condition. As a result, acquire the subset of data, that is, the filtered DataFrame. Finally, the rows of the dataframe are filtered and the output is as shown in the above ... dayvigo prior authorization criteriaWebFeb 13, 2024 · Pandas Series.filter () function returns subset rows or columns of dataframe according to labels in the specified index. Please note that this routine does not filter a dataframe on its contents. The filter is applied to the labels of the index.
